Walkingtogether
‘Walkingtogether’ is a program of walks run by qualified health walk leaders/first aiders from different locations across the London Borough of Hackney.
Walking is an excellent activity to participate in, it’s a safe activity which helps to improve health as well as:
- making you feel good
- increases bone density
- giving you more energy
- reducing stress
- helping to manage weight
- helping you to sleep better
- helping to reduce blood pressure.
The ‘walkingtogether’ program offers a range of walks which take place in parks with in the London Borough of Hackney. The group walks are a great way to socialise, meet new people, enjoy the park and get healthy.
The health walks are suitable for all ages and vary in difficulty. All walks are free led walks and are appropriate for those who are beginners.
The walks are led by a qualified health walks leaders and first aider, the free walks last up to 45 minutes to 60 minutes.
